Jump and Voice Recorder: AI Note Taker are both AI meeting assistants for recording, transcription, and summaries, compared here on pricing, features, and workflow fit. Jump: AI meeting assistant built for financial advisors that handles notes, follow-ups, compliance documentation, and CRM updates. Voice Recorder: AI Note Taker: iOS recorder app that captures meetings, lectures, and calls, then transcribes and summarizes them with AI. Pros & cons
Jump
+ Purpose-built for financial advisors' compliance and documentation needs
+ Automates pre-meeting prep as well as post-meeting notes and tasks
- Tailored to financial services, so less general-purpose than broad notetakers
Voice Recorder: AI Note Taker
+ Records on-device for in-person meetings, lectures, and calls
+ Wide range of export formats for transcripts and audio
- Available on iOS only based on the official listing
